Output 7a23434a06178104d80ccdddfdf8d534b1b22e5eaaf9c0829c9e6b64c421b319:27

value
11745026
script pubkey
OP_0 OP_PUSHBYTES_20 c3bfbbdb27941d4d699ed990b89c52c0fa09190e
address
ltc1qcwlmhke8jsw566v7mxgt38zjcraqjxgwj9q6y4
transaction
7a23434a06178104d80ccdddfdf8d534b1b22e5eaaf9c0829c9e6b64c421b319
spent
false